Académie française autograph collection
Collection
Call Number: GEN MSS 1339
Overview:
Correspondence and other documents signed by circa 200 members of the Académie française, 1637-1926 and undated, assembled by an unidentified collector, possibly American autograph collector Howes Norris, Jr. (1867-1938), of Vineyard Haven, Massachusetts. Most are autograph letters, signed; other contents include literary writings, legal documents, and a few documents concerning administration of the Académie française. Davies/Scroggie collection of Canadian fur trade documents
Collection
Call Number: WA MSS S-2357
Overview:
The collection consists of printed contracts completed in manuscript between Canadian voyageurs and their outfitters (1801-1821) and other documents relating to the Canadian fur trade, including correspondence, financial papers, and legal documents (1724-1856). Outfitters include M'Tavish, Frobisher & Co., M'Tavish, M'Gillivrays & Co., and the American Fur Company. Destinations include Michilimackinac, Grand Portage, Rainy Lake, Fort William, and "Posts of the Northwest in Upper Canada."
Dates:
1724-1856
